Motorola Luge Price

At the time of it's release in 2014, August, the manufacturer's retail price for a new Motorola Luge was about 240 EUR.

Specifications

Network

Technology: GSM / CDMA / HSPA / EVDO / LTE
2G bands: GSM 850 / 900 / 1800 / 1900
: CDMA2000 1xEV-DO
3G bands: HSDPA 850 / 900 / 1900 / 2100
4G bands: 13
Speed: HSPA 21.1/5.76 Mbps, LTE, EV-DO Rev.A 3.1 Mbps

Launch

Announced: 2014, August. Released 2014, August
Status: Discontinued

Body

Dimensions: 122.4 x 60.7 x 8.4 mm (4.82 x 2.39 x 0.33 in)
Weight: 125.9 g (4.44 oz)
SIM: Micro-SIM
: Splash resistant

Display

Type: Super AMOLED Advanced
Size: 4.3 inches, 51.0 cm2 (~68.6% screen-to-body ratio)
Resolution: 540 x 960 pixels, 16:9 ratio (~256 ppi density)
Protection: Corning Gorilla Glass 2

Platform

OS: Android 4.4.2 (KitKat)
Chipset: Qualcomm MSM8960 Snapdragon S4 Plus
CPU: Dual-core 1.5 GHz Krait
GPU: Adreno 225

Memory

Card slot: microSDHC (dedicated slot)
Internal: 8GB 1GB RAM

Main Camera

Single: 8 MP, AF
Features: LED flash
Video: 1080p@30fps

Selfie camera

Single: VGA
Video: 720p

Sound

Loudspeaker: Yes
3.5mm jack: Yes

Comms

WLAN: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n, dual-band, DLNA, hotspot
Bluetooth: 4.0, A2DP, EDR, aptX
Positioning: GPS, S-GPS, GLONASS
NFC: No
Radio: No
USB: microUSB 2.0

Features

Sensors: Accelerometer, proximity, compass

Battery

Type: Li-Ion 2000 mAh, non-removable
Stand-by: Up to 408 h (3G)
Talk time: Up to 20 h (3G)

Misc

Colors: Black
SAR: 1.30 W/kg (head)     0.63 W/kg (body)
